Carl Rushworth joined Albion from Halifax Town in 2019. 

After spending the second half of the 2019/20 season with Worthing, he joined Walsall in July 2021 and made 43 appearances for the League Two club.

A year later he linked up with League One Lincoln City, making more than 40 appearances, before a successful loan with Swansea City in the Championship for the 2023/24 campaign.

With the Swans he made 48 appearances across all competitions and kept 11 clean sheets ; he also won the club’s Player of the Season award.

Having spent the first of the 2024/25 season on loan with Hull City, he was recalled to be backup to Bart Verbruggen following an injury sustained by Jason Steele.

He has represented England at under-19, under-20, under-21 and under-23 level – and was part of the England squad that won the European Under-21 Championships in 2023.
